The Suspenders Gallery Matrix Pendant with Chiclets is an intricate web of texture and interest. Four tiers of interconnected power bars support suspended LED etched glass chiclet luminaires, forming an orderly, captivating composition across your space. This configuration is made up of 35 single etched chiclet luminaires and 43 three-light etched chiclet cluster luminaires.
Note: Two transformers are included, to be installed in a remote accessible location.

Robert Sonneman pioneered modern lighting making it an art form. World renowned and acclaimed for clean lines and alliance to form and function, his world famous award winning designs have been at the forefront of the design world for over four decades. Robert introduced sleek, new functionalist lighting designs in the 60s and 70s that have become classics of the modern era. Today, SONNEMAN A Way of Light's designs build on the pioneering work of Robert Sonneman. The brand's range extends through the modern architectural and decorative genres of the 20th century and forward to the contemporary diversity of the 21st century. "Light shapes space, determines perception and sets the mood and tone of an environment" said Robert Sonneman.
